UpdateThis week students are continuing to focus on verbs and sentence combining. However, now students are facing the more difficult task of learning the meaning of root words. For example, this week we learned that if "incredible" means "not able to be believed," then "credible" means "able to be believed" and "cred" means "to believe". These root word tasks are essential to making high schools on the ACT and are part of new English Standards handed down from the TN State Dept of Education.
